French SAMU Professional Medical Regulation Assistants
In France there is a SAMU where in each capital town hospital there is the Regulator Medical Center of the French county (Département) EMS. This central hub "regulates" all the Emergency care resources of the area from Firefighters and First Aid EMT vehicles to Hospital Medicalized ground or helicoptered MICUs, but also Hospital Emergency Wards, Intensive care Units, GP and Private basic Ambulances on call. This is more than anglosaxon EMS and could be called IEMS (Integrated Emergency Medical System). The Medical Doctor Regulator has a team of assistants called PARM and recently defined by French Public Health Ministry as medical care paraprofessionals .
